The quality of eggs and sperm can directly affect the development of the embryo and the health of the child. This article will focus on testing the quality of eggs. Before couples want to have children, they should test whether their eggs and sperm are healthy.

Test method : Starting from the first day of a woman's menstruation, place the thermometer under the tongue for 5 minutes before getting up and moving around every morning and record the results. Continue testing until the next menstruation.

Test result analysis:

① In a month, women's physiological changes are roughly divided into before and after ovulation, which are scientifically called the "follicular phase" and the "luteal phase". Generally, the basal body temperature in the follicular phase is 36.5°C. If the basal body temperature rises by more than 0.5°C in the luteal phase and remains high for more than ten days, it means ovulation. If there is no later increase in body temperature curve in the monophasic type, it indicates no ovulation. The accuracy rate is 70%~80%.

② Normally ovulation occurs around the 14th day of menstruation. After ovulation, the body temperature rises by 0.3~0.5℃ and lasts for about 12 days. If the body temperature does not rise or rises slowly, lasts for a short time or rises less than 0.3℃, it means that ovulation has not occurred or the corpus luteum is not supplying enough energy.

③The high temperature period after the rise will last for 12-16 days. If the high temperature period is longer, it will indicate that the egg quality is good. If it continues for more than 20 days, you may be pregnant. If there is no pregnancy, the corpus luteum shrinks and stops secreting progesterone, and the body temperature will begin to drop until it returns to the baseline, which is the body temperature at the time of the last menstrual period.

Test Note:

①First, you need to buy a basal thermometer. The basal thermometer is different from a general thermometer. Its scale is denser, and 36.7 degrees Celsius (24 on the scale) is generally used as the boundary between high and low temperatures.

② Buy a basal body temperature chart (available in hospitals, for download online, or you can make one yourself using an EXCEL spreadsheet online), record the measured body temperature every day, and make it appear as a wavy line.

③ If you have a cold or fever, drank alcohol the night before, used an electric blanket, etc., your body temperature may be inaccurate. Use it with caution during the pregnancy preparation period, and also prevent colds.
